> Hi,
>
> The egrep regex should not escape the '{' and '}', and also add a check
> for ' \t' so that we do not pickup stuff like '+----', etc. Fix typo in
> assignment. Check if file exists in new tree before adding/removing
> (might add support for this lowlevel to increase speed?). Fix typo in
> line removing temp files.
>
> Signed-off-by: Martin Schlemmer <azarah@gentoo.org>
Thanks for the merge and typo fixes. I can't imagine how, but it really
appeared to work for me that time!
I'm confused however what does the exits_in_cache() (what exits? exists?)
gives us, apart of horribly-looking code. What bug does it fix?
